But return i got this,

Description Qty Unit Price Price
----------------------------------------------------------------------------
80 Sager 4780-S Notebook: 4780-S 1 $2277.00
984 Display: 17" WXGA LCD
981 Processor: 3.0GHZ P4 800 FSB w/
Hyperthreading
558 Video: Radeon 9600 PRO 128MB DDR (M10-P)
987 RAM: 1024MB 400DDR (PC3200)
842 Hard Drive: 60GB 7200RPM
854 Media Drive: 2X DVD-RW/CD-RW
350 Modem: 56K RJ11 Phone Modem
853 Network Card: 10/100/1000 NIC
470 TV Tuner: NTSC TV Tuner and Remote
354 Battery: Primary Li-ION battery pack
355 Case: Basic Black business case
769 Wireless Network: Internal Wireless
